After we got them mounted we had a problem with interference. Whenever the car was off they looked perfect but once the car was on they would get all of these waves in them and if you stepped on the gas pedal at all you could barely see the picture. Anyways, we figured out that the alternator was causing the interference and we had to splice into a different power source. We were splicing into the power wire that was coming straight from the battery to the head unit but then we were wondering why the headunit was playing clearly but the visors weren't. Then we noticed this little box on the wire:

Once we saw the box we figured it might some type of interference eliminator so we tried splicing into the wire after it and what do you know. Clean picture even when revving the engine!!
